Christchurch four-piece Les Baxters assembled early last year and immediately began creating doomy sci-fi exotica. Despite having only recently formed as band, Les Baxters consists of long-time friends John Chrisstoffels, Dave Imlay, Paul Sutherland and Erin Kimber, all of whom have been around the Christchurch music scene for a long time and feature in other seminal acts including Into The Void, The Terminals and Fence.

Heavily influenced by post-quake Christchurch, horror movies, and interesting instruments they create a textural, dynamic and transcendent sonics that are unique, surprising and have an immersive quality. UnderTheRadar spoke with synth-player Erin Kimber to find out more about this mysterious group...
